Why this name?
It's my first and middle name. One from the Old Testament, and one from the New Testament. zombieKAT represents living a life of being dead to self. Also that I've died ten times and I still came back. :D Shut up.
Do you play live?
I play wherver I can myself behind a microphone. I'll play for youth groups, small concerts, large concerts, back yard partes, front yard parties, LAN parties, Republican parties, Democratic parties, third parties, fundraisers, funerals, etc... I'm not super picky.

Equipment used:
Well, my beats are made with acid DJ, my Korg EM-1 drum machine, my Yamaha (consumer model) keyboard, my guitar, and anything I can use to sample. I use a free download drum machine called Hammerhead Rythm station... Look that one up. It's fun. I make funny noises with my mouth.
